A sharp escalation in regional tensions is unfolding as Iran continues launching waves of missiles and unmanned aerial vehicles toward Israeli territory, triggering air-raid sirens across multiple cities. The repeated strikes mark one of the most intense phases of the confrontation since hostilities surged in late February 2026.

🔥 Multiple Targets Under Pressure:
Recent reports indicate that several attacks have been directed at central population centers and strategic military locations, with some projectiles reportedly carrying specialized warheads. Emergency services have been deployed amid accounts of structural damage and casualties, while authorities work to ᴀssess the full scale of the impact.

✈️ Sky Filled With Intercepts and Explosions:
Witnesses describe the night sky illuminated by interception attempts and secondary blasts as air defense systems engaged incoming threats. The continuous nature of the ᴀssaults has heightened public anxiety and placed sustained operational strain on defensive networks designed to protect major urban areas.

⚠️ From Retaliation to Prolonged Confrontation:
Analysts suggest that the pattern of repeated strikes signals a shift from isolated retaliatory exchanges to a broader and more sustained military confrontation. The pace and intensity of the attacks have raised concerns among international observers about the potential for further escalation and regional spillover.

🌍 Critical Question for Regional Security:
With defenses facing relentless pressure, military experts are closely monitoring whether existing air defense systems can maintain effectiveness over extended periods.
The unfolding situation highlights the fragile balance between deterrence, technological capability, and the risks of a widening conflict in an already volatile environment.
